Social economic responsibility has evolved. The concept now encompasses initiatives geared at the public and staff members alike. Companies have incorporated social economic responsibility in almost all aspects of their company operations. Suppliers are now expected to have sound employee policies, the production process has been made cost efficient, environmentally friendly and sustainable to the public.

The environment in simple terms could be described as the stimulus or external resources or conditions around which an organism will interact with. We can distinguish between three kinds of environments. These are the social environment, the natural environment and the built environment.
